Single checkboxes are distinct because:
- they don't need to be wrapped in a `<fieldset>`
- they are a subclass of BooleanField so their
data is either True or False
Nested checkboxes with a single top-level node
will only have one item in their `items` list.
This is because the other choices are children of
that list item.
This means we need to check the `choices`
attribute, which lists all the checkboxes, to see
if they should be marked as a group (by being
wrapped in a `<fieldset>`) or not.

‘Commonly used passwords’ is more specific, and avoids the terminology
‘blacklist’ which the National Cyber Security Centre explain to be
problematic:
> It's fairly common to say whitelisting and blacklisting to describe desirable and undesirable things in cyber security. For instance, when talking about which applications you will allow or deny on your corporate network; or deciding which bad passwords you want your users not to be able to use.
>
> However, there's an issue with the terminology. It only makes sense if you equate white with 'good, permitted, safe' and black with 'bad, dangerous, forbidden'. There are some obvious problems with this. So in the name of helping to stamp out racism in cyber security, we will
> avoid this casually pejorative wording on our website in the future. No, it's not the biggest issue in the world - but to borrow a slogan from elsewhere: every little helps.
– https://www.ncsc.gov.uk/blog-post/terminology-its-not-black-and-white
International letters don’t have a choice of postage. Under the hood
they are either `europe` or `rest-of-world`.
So, for letters that we detect are international, this commit:
- removes the radios buttons that give users the choice of postage
- passes through either `europe` or `rest-of-world` to the API,
depending on what address we find in the letter
This will cause the API to 500 until it can accept `europe` or
`rest-of-world` as postage types, but this is probably OK because it’s
only our services that have international letters switched on at the
moment.

For services with permission, they can now put international addresses
into their spreadsheets without getting a postcode error.
This also means they can start using address line 7 instead of postcode,
since it doesn’t make sense to put a country in a field called
‘postcode’. But this will be undocumented to start with, because we’re
not giving any real users the permission.
It does now mean that the number of possible placeholders (7 + postcode)
is greater than the number of allowed placeholders (7), so we have to
account for that in the one-off address flow where we’re populating the
placeholders automatically. We’re sticking with 6 + postcode here for
backwards compatibility.
This involves three changes which broke our code.
To validate email addresses, the optional dependency `email-validator`
must be installed<sup>1</sup>. But since we don’t use WTForms’ email
validation, we shouldn’t need to subclass it – it can just be its own
self contained thing. Then we don’t need to add the extra dependency.
When rendering textareas, and extra `\r\n` is inserted at the beginning
<sup>2</sup>. Browsers will strip this when displaying the textbox and
submitting the form, but some of our tests need updating to account for
this.
The error message for when you don’t choose an option from some radio
buttons has now changed. Rather than just accepting WTForms’ new
message, this commit makes the error messages like the examples from
the Design System<sup>3</sup>. By default it will say ‘Select an
option’, but by passing in an extra parameter (`thing`) it can be
customised to be more specific, for example ‘Select a type of
organisation’.

I noticed when using the dication software that saying ‘one two three
four five’ got dictated as `123 45`. This tripped the validation,
because the space character isn’t a digit.
So this commit normalises out spaces (and other spacing characters like
dashes and underscores) before validating the code and sending it to the
API.
I can also imagine that some people might like to space out the code to
make it easier to transcribe (like you might do with a credit card
number).

We can’t give advice to members of the public, but increasingly we’re
seeing them try to use our support form to ask.
It would be better for them if we can direct them straight to somewhere
more useful, before they have the chance to raise a support ticket.
This commit replaces the report a problem/ask a question triaging for
users who aren’t signed in. It’s not possible for non-signed-in users to
raise an priority 1 ticket, so we never need to triage the tickets in
this way.
Instead we can triage people based on whether they work in the public
sector or not. If they do then we send them on to the feedback form. If
not then they go to a new page which contains some useful links. We’ve
chosen these links based on some analysis of the support tickets we’ve
received recently[1]
